ABOUT US


Muslim Hands SA is a Cape Town-based international NGO that works in the areas of disaster relief and sustainable development.

Muslim Hands operates in over 40 countries worldwide, distributing life-saving humanitarian aid and relief to millions of people around the world, who are affected by natural disasters, war, poverty, famine, and drought.


THE ROLE


As a Programmes Assistant focusing on local programmes, this role is crucial in expanding the presence and reach of Muslim Hands South Africa nationally.

The purpose of this role is to develop programmes that support vulnerable communities across South Africa and will require a high level of engagement with beneficiaries to support them through various programme areas including WASH, food and livelihoods assistance, health, and education.

As the Programmes Assistant, you will be responsible for:


1.


Local Project Management:


  • Lead on the delivery of local projects by managing project lifecycles including carrying out needs assessments, drafting proposals and budgets as well as project implementation and reporting.
  • Manage the daytoday running of local projects including compliance with project management requirements as well as compliance with local and national regulations.
  • Assist management with developing a national programmes strategy and expanding the national presence of Muslim Hands South Africa by identifying, assessing, and formulating ideas to support vulnerable local communities in line with national objectives which will require maintaining a good understanding of national priorities and development goals.
  • Liaise and work closely with fundraising and events teams as well as other departments to provide timely and accurate feedback as well as supporting fundraising and promotional activities.
  • Ensure relationships with partners and suppliers are maintained and developed.
  • Support the coordination of volunteers engaging with local projects.
  • Actively work to improve the quality and scale of existing and future projects and provide regular updates to management.

2.


International Project Support:


  • Assist when required with the management of international project lifecycles, including requesting, reviewing, and approving project concept notes, proposals, and budgets across various thematic areas.
  • Provide support in providing feedback to donors and managing where required donor complaints and concerns.

3.


Other:


  • Promote and adhere to all Muslim Hands Policies, Procedures and Professional Practices.
  • Adhere to all safeguarding requirements especially when dealing with vulnerable beneficiaries and ensure risks are mitigated and highlighted.
  • Assist with any other duties as reasonably required to support the organization.
